Jean-Claude Truchet is a character from the Donkey Kong Planet skit "La nuit des vivants-morts." An undead journalist, he partakes in unusually mundane activities such as having breakfast in the morning, brushing his teeth with a wire brush, and going to work. He resides in a neighborhood with other zombies.
Jean-Claude is deathly afraid of living people, particularly office clerks and math teachers, fleeing in terror after he encounters a math-teaching Donkey Kong at his office late at night. When he tries to hide behind a desk, he is ambushed by Donkey Kong and other office clerks that start reciting geometry facts.
